Super Vegeta's Performance: Strength, Speed, and Stature

When Vegeta first unleashes his Super Saiyan Grade 2 form, the differences are immediately apparent. His muscles become more defined, and his aura crackles with intense energy. He looks larger than his normal Super Saiyan form, giving him a more intimidating appearance. He’s not just stronger; he’s also faster and more resilient. The controlled ki output also means that he can sustain this form for longer periods, which is a major advantage in combat. His confidence soars. Finally, he feels as if he can beat the Androids, and he's not wrong!

The first demonstration of this form is a showdown with Android 19. The fight is brief, but the result is clear: Vegeta is far more powerful than the android. He completely dominates the fight, showcasing not only his increased strength but also his tactical prowess. This victory is a significant moment for Vegeta, as it marks a turning point in his character arc. He achieves his first major victory against the Androids. The fight with Android 19 is a demonstration of pure power. In this fight, Vegeta demonstrates how much he has improved from the original Super Saiyan form.

Next comes the real test: Cell. Vegeta initially overpowers Semi-Perfect Cell. The Saiyan Prince is able to overwhelm Cell due to his new transformation. His power and speed are far above what Cell can deal with. The fight is intense, but the most important thing is that Vegeta is stronger than Cell. He easily beats Cell. The fight is short-lived, however, as Vegeta gives Cell a Senzu Bean to trigger his Perfect Form. This moment of arrogance and overconfidence proves to be a critical mistake, and one that nearly costs him his life and the lives of those he wants to protect.

The Downfall and Legacy of Super Vegeta

While Super Vegeta is a powerhouse, it's not without its flaws. The biggest drawback is its drain on stamina. It's more taxing than the first Super Saiyan form, and the user can't sustain it for as long. Vegeta's arrogance also comes into play. He underestimates Cell and gives him the chance to become Perfect Cell, which is his biggest mistake. This hubris nearly destroys the Earth and leads to Vegeta's ultimate defeat at the hands of Cell. He let his pride get in the way. It's a harsh lesson for Vegeta, but one that shapes his future decisions. He learned that raw power isn't everything.
